Conversion formula
The conversion factor from cubic feet to deciliters is 283.168467117, which means that 1 cubic foot is equal to 283.168467117 deciliters:
1 ft3 = 283.168467117 dL
To convert 9842 cubic feet into deciliters we have to multiply 9842 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from cubic feet to deciliters.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:
1 ft3 → 283.168467117 dL
9842 ft3 → V(dL)
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in deciliters:
V(dL) = 9842 ft3 × 283.168467117 dL
V(dL) = 2786944.0533655 dL
The final result is:
9842 ft3 → 2786944.0533655 dL
We conclude that 9842 cubic feet is equivalent to 2786944.0533655 deciliters:
9842 cubic feet = 2786944.0533655 deciliters
